Across TCGA patient cohorts, SSTR4 protein abundance is significantly associated with the RNA expression of many other genes, with 860 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ible SSTR4-associated genes across cancer lineages are TOP3B, APOL1, and HDAC10. Each is linked with SSTR4 in more than 1 cancer types. Because this analysis shows association rather than direction, both SSTR4-to-partner and partner-to-SSTR4 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, SSTR4 versus TOP3B in UCEC, with a Pearson correlation of -0.36.
